Asexuality in Filipino Dating

Filipinos are known for their romantic nature, but for those who identify as asexual, the dating scene can be quite challenging.

Asexuality is often misunderstood, and many Filipinos who identify as asexual struggle to find their place in the country's romantic and family-oriented culture.

Asexual individuals may face unique challenges in navigating commitment, as their lack of sexual attraction can lead to misconceptions about their ability to form deep emotional connections.

In the Filipino context, asexuality is not widely discussed or understood, and many asexual individuals may feel pressured to conform to societal expectations of romance and relationships.

However, commitment can take many forms beyond romantic love, and asexual Filipinos can and do form strong, committed relationships with partners who understand and respect their identity.

These relationships may involve deep emotional bonds, shared values, and a strong sense of mutual support.

For asexual Filipinos, commitment may mean finding a partner who accepts and loves them for who they are, without expecting sexual attraction or intimacy.

It may involve building a life together, sharing responsibilities, and creating a sense of home and belonging.

  • Open communication and mutual respect are key to successful asexual relationships
  • Trust, empathy, and understanding are essential for navigating the complexities of asexuality
  • A strong support system, including friends, family, and community, can make a significant difference in the lives of asexual Filipinos

By embracing diversity and promoting inclusivity, Filipinos can work towards creating a more accepting and supportive environment for individuals of all sexual orientations, including those who identify as asexual.

Virtual Communication in Filipino Relationships

Virtual communication has revolutionized the way Filipinos interact with each other, especially in romantic relationships.

With the rise of social media and online dating, it's now easier for people to connect with others from all over the country.

However, this increased connectivity also raises questions about commitment.

Can virtual communication lead to deeper commitment, or does it create a false sense of intimacy?

On one hand, virtual communication can be beneficial for relationships.

It allows couples to stay in touch constantly, regardless of physical distance.

  • It provides an opportunity for people to get to know each other better, sharing thoughts and feelings through text or video calls.
  • Virtual communication can also help couples resolve conflicts more efficiently, as they can discuss issues in real-time.

On the other hand, excessive virtual communication can create a sense of detachment.

  1. Overreliance on digital communication can lead to a lack of face-to-face interaction, which is essential for building a strong emotional connection.
  2. It can also create unrealistic expectations, as people may present a curated version of themselves online.

Ultimately, the key to successful commitment in Filipino relationships is finding a balance between virtual and in-person communication.

By being aware of the pros and cons of digital communication, couples can harness its benefits while nurturing a deeper, more meaningful connection.

Digital Flirting in Filipino Culture

Filipinos are known for their flirtatious nature, and digital flirting has become a significant aspect of their relationships.

Digital flirting can be a harmless way to show interest, but it can also lead to commitment issues if not handled carefully.

In the Filipino culture, digital flirting is often seen as a way to test the waters, to gauge the other person's interest without making a direct commitment.

However, this can lead to misunderstandings and mixed signals, especially if the other person is not aware of the intentions behind the flirting.

In the context of Filipino relationships, digital flirting can be a double-edged sword.

On the one hand, it can be a fun and exciting way to get to know someone, to build a connection and create a sense of excitement.

On the other hand, it can also lead to unrealistic expectations and a lack of genuine commitment.

To navigate this complex issue, it's essential to consider the following:

  • Be clear about your intentions: If you're interested in someone, be direct and honest about your intentions.
  • Communicate openly: Talk to the other person about your feelings and expectations to avoid misunderstandings.
  • Respect boundaries: Don't push someone to commit if they're not ready, and respect their decision if they're not interested.

By being mindful of these factors, Filipinos can use digital flirting as a way to build connections and strengthen their relationships, rather than creating commitment issues.

Building a Strong Filipino Relationship

Building a strong Filipino relationship requires a deep understanding of the cultural nuances that shape commitment.

Trust is the foundation of any successful partnership, and in Filipino relationships, it's no different.

However, the way trust is established and maintained can vary significantly.

For instance, Filipinos tend to place a high value on loyalty and dedication, which can sometimes be misinterpreted as clinginess or possessiveness.

To navigate this, couples must learn to communicate effectively, respecting each other's boundaries while also being receptive to the needs of their partner.

Effective communication is crucial in any relationship, and in Filipino relationships, it's essential to strike a balance between openness and respect.

Filipinos are known for their strong family ties and close-knit communities, which can sometimes lead to external influences on the relationship.

To mitigate this, couples must establish clear boundaries and prioritize their partnership.

Some key elements of a strong Filipino relationship include:

  • Emotional intelligence: being able to understand and manage one's emotions, as well as being empathetic towards their partner
  • Respect for tradition and culture: acknowledging and respecting the cultural heritage of their partner and their family
  • Compromise and adaptability: being able to find common ground and adapt to changing circumstances

By focusing on these elements, couples can build a strong foundation for their relationship, one that is rooted in mutual respect, trust, and effective communication.
